Capturing good lighting in photography is an artwork form that requires a mix of technical skill and intuition. Understanding the assorted aspects of sunshine can tremendously improve the quality of your pictures. Light can both make or break an image, and understanding how to use it effectively can transform odd topics into stunning visuals.


Natural light is commonly thought of your finest option for photography, because it provides a delicate, even illumination that can be flattering to most subjects. The golden hour, which happens shortly after dawn and before sunset, provides a heat subtle light that can elevate your outside pictures. This time of day creates lengthy shadows and a novel atmosphere that pulls the viewer's eye, making it a favourite amongst photographers.


Understanding the place of the solar throughout the day can help you plan your shoots strategically - Photography Packages Orlando. Midday solar can be harsh and unflattering, creating deep shadows that may distort your topic. In this case, using shade or discovering a extra favorable location might help you seize higher lighting with out the extremes of brightness.


When shooting indoors, window gentle is a incredible choice to consider. Natural gentle filtering via home windows provides a soft, pleasing high quality to images. Positioning your subject near the window can create beautiful highlights and shadows, amplifying texture and depth in your photographs. Curtains or sheer material can diffuse the light even additional, preventing harsh contrasts.

Artificial lighting can also play a significant function in photography. Understanding the varied kinds of light sources—such as LED lights, strobes, and continuous lights—allows for versatile shooting options. Using softboxes or reflectors may help soften harsh shadows and management the course of the light. This makes it simpler to realize the desired temper and aesthetic.


Experimenting with gentle modifiers can lead to exciting outcomes. Umbrellas and softboxes can spread and diffuse light, making a gentle, flattering glow round your topics. Conversely, using grid spots or snoots can create dramatic shadows and defined highlights, which can improve specific components within your body. Every modification allows for creative exploration and might drastically change the final photograph.


Another side to think about is the white steadiness in your digital camera settings. Different light sources have distinctive color temperatures that may affect the general look of your images. Using the proper settings ensures that colors appear extra natural. Auto white steadiness works in many circumstances, but handbook adjustments can present greater management, especially in blended lighting situations.

Understanding the idea of exposure is essential when capturing good lighting. A well-exposed photograph balances the light throughout the scene, capturing details in each highlights and shadows. The three main elements to attain this balance are aperture, shutter pace, and ISO. Adjusting these settings can permit for beautiful renditions of light, whether you need a shallow depth of field or to freeze movement in brilliant circumstances.


Utilizing the histogram on your digital camera can be a useful tool. It offers a visual representation of the tonal vary in your image, serving to you make adjustments in actual time. By maintaining your histogram throughout the boundaries, you'll have the ability to keep away from clipped highlights and deep shadows that can detract from the great thing about your composition.


Post-processing is a superb way to refine the lighting in your images additional. Software like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op provides varied tools to boost exposure, contrast, and shade balance. You could make subtle changes that may dramatically improve how mild interacts with your photograph, bringing out details that will have been misplaced straight out of the camera.

Incorporating outside parts can even enhance the lighting of your photographs. Reflective surfaces, like water or sand, can bounce light onto your topic, creating a unique and fascinating glow. Similarly, city environments filled with glass and metallic can present fascinating reflections and high-contrast gentle patterns, adding depth and complexity to your photographs.


For photographers who wish to push creative boundaries, capturing in low-light situations can yield fascinating results. This scenario requires an excellent understanding of your camera's capabilities as properly as a gradual hand or a tripod. Low light can create moody, atmospheric pictures that seize emotion and intrigue. Experimenting with longer exposures can result in stunning visuals that showcase movement and light-weight in unique ways.


Always keep in thoughts that practice makes good. Regularly experimenting with completely different lighting conditions and settings will refine your capability to seize the most effective light possible. Keeping a journal or log relating to what works and what doesn’t might help in understanding how totally different gentle influences your style and results.
